WebFeb 22, 2024 · Here’s how to handle it with just a little bit of trim carpentry: Step 1. Lift to Fit Plan on a seam in the middle of the doorway. Notch and cut the first piece to fit and then slide it completely under the jamb. Notch the second piece so it’ll be just short of the doorstop when it’s in place. WebSep 24, 2024 · STEP 3. Slide a wide, 6-inch drywall knife between the wall and the baseboard. Then, insert your flat bar between the knife and board. It can be used in a pinch to cut a piece or two of laminate but you are likely to be unhappy with … WebJan 26, 2024 · Cut The Laminate Use a jigsaw to make curves A jigsaw is a common tool for this kind of cutting. Mark the cutting lines with your marker and the paper template or profile gauge. Carefully move the saw along the marked lines to make the cuts. When you're done, hold the cut laminate against the obstacle to confirm the shape. WebNov 27, 2024 · Use a reducer laminate transition strip when you are transitioning from a higher surface to a lower surface. Oftentimes, a reducer transition strip is used to transition from laminate to carpet. It can also be used to transition from laminate to linoleum or tile.
